Buying Guide for Electrical Plug for RV

Understanding My RV’s Power Requirements

Before I started looking for an electrical plug for my RV, I made sure to understand the power requirements of my vehicle. RVs typically use 30-amp or 50-amp electrical systems, so knowing the amperage and voltage my RV needs helped me narrow down my choices. Checking the manufacturer’s specifications or the existing power cord was my first step.

Choosing the Right Plug Type

There are different plug types designed for RV electrical connections, such as TT-30 for 30-amp systems and the larger 50-amp plugs. I needed to match the plug type with my RV’s inlet and the available campground power pedestal. Using the wrong plug can cause damage or unsafe conditions, so compatibility was crucial.

Evaluating Build Quality and Durability

Since the electrical plug would be exposed to outdoor elements, I prioritized plugs made with durable materials like heavy-duty rubber or thermoplastic. The construction needed to be sturdy to withstand frequent plugging and unplugging, as well as exposure to moisture and temperature changes.

Safety Features I Looked For

Safety was a top priority for me. I checked for plugs with features such as grounding, secure locking mechanisms, and weatherproof covers to prevent accidental disconnections or water ingress. Certifications from recognized safety organizations also gave me confidence in the product’s reliability.
